Chinese toy maker Rocket Craft is not only making some of the cutest toys any six-year-old kid would like to have, but even some really good replicates of motorcycle and car engines and... yes, cars. They are all made of plush and come in smaller scale, but still imagine a Nissan GT-R sitting next to your desk, inspiring you every day.

Sure, there’s a long range of cars you can opt from starting with most of the Toyota, Nissan and Honda models, going through some of the Chinese cars and ending with “foreign countries” such as Lamborghini Gallardo, Dodge Ram, BMW E34 and Mercedes-Benz 300 SL Gullwing.

Depending on the model the plushy vehicles range between 35 to 45 cm (14 to 18 inches) in size and will cost you 45,000 yen ($380). You can even ask for a license plate which will cost you an additional 4,000 yen ($34).
